8a2fbc92ff
remove unused binaries
2025-11-19 10:39:51 +01:00
1cd7f4f8a8
remove unused configurations
2025-11-19 10:39:51 +01:00
d7dc99c004
fix: use the satalite workspace update script in PATH, rather than direct path
2025-11-19 10:39:51 +01:00
4994241a7a
remove xprofile file, since it is unsed, and causes issues with bash_profile being sourced multiple times
2025-11-19 10:39:51 +01:00
84359d914d
include i3 and nvim configuration in the central repository, rather than keep them in their seperate respective ones.
2025-11-19 10:39:51 +01:00
a50ead749a
move xdg directories to the default location.
...
a lot of applications seem to hardcode this location, so it's better to
have something default, or default-adjasoned.
2025-11-19 10:39:51 +01:00
f6b93d5126
fix: rework error code writing / simplify it
2025-11-19 10:39:51 +01:00
3555219aa1
fix: POSIX compatibility case written incorrectly
2025-11-19 10:39:51 +01:00
a0b972d106
rework bash scripts to be completely, or mostly POSIX-compliant
2025-11-19 10:39:51 +01:00
cc07925346
remove a bunch of crap I don't use
2025-11-19 10:39:51 +01:00
18549ab4b9
move alias definitions to a seperate file to decrease clutter
2025-11-19 10:39:51 +01:00
7e1c0dc937
remove vcpkg crap we no longer use
2025-11-19 10:39:51 +01:00
a9f8e39373
rework the bash PS1 prompt
2025-11-19 10:39:51 +01:00
50d75707a0
fix: shbangs in bash configuration files
2025-11-19 10:39:51 +01:00
8df76cc477
remove git modules
2025-11-19 10:39:51 +01:00
398d5d8316
update nvim
2025-11-19 10:39:51 +01:00
da95e3e657
add another arch ascii art, but with lower resolution to be usable in a tty
2025-11-19 10:39:51 +01:00
0f9f565362
flip flop java prime
2025-11-19 10:39:51 +01:00
10a046a20d
define an alias for info
2025-11-19 10:39:51 +01:00
e0e280d296
use command for detection over which
2025-11-19 10:39:51 +01:00
8802bc1a7f
write comment
2025-11-19 10:39:51 +01:00
840a258e12
add shrug to xcompose
2025-11-19 10:39:51 +01:00
5e259b841f
add indentical to sybol to xcompose
2025-11-19 10:39:51 +01:00
7465658a84
rework volume control
2025-11-19 10:39:51 +01:00
fa77ae3f7a
edit editorconfig to have JSON have tab width of eight
2025-11-19 10:39:51 +01:00
71d38679c8
fix keybind to open
2025-11-19 10:39:51 +01:00
fbdd43b161
update submodules
2025-11-19 10:39:51 +01:00
71ddd81bb3
update lazygit
2025-11-19 10:39:51 +01:00
2088afe587
add LF configuration
2025-11-19 10:39:51 +01:00
3a5922d362
add roman numerals to xcompose
2025-11-19 10:39:51 +01:00
e37a28f5cb
update i3
2025-11-19 10:39:51 +01:00
0c2aca8e39
add W.I.P. projection for europe.
2025-11-19 10:39:51 +01:00
7f7a907612
update i3
2025-11-19 10:39:51 +01:00
9e6a64346b
fix typo in satalite wp update
2025-11-19 10:39:51 +01:00
50dfae9ddd
update nvim
2025-11-19 10:39:51 +01:00
655f2fc889
comment out rando lines in actrc
2025-11-19 10:39:51 +01:00
04001d4530
add lines to fastfetch
2025-11-19 10:39:51 +01:00
7b2b61d2ca
set a font size in kitty to what I am comfortable with
...
Kitty did not have a font size set, and I kept accedentally zooming in,
and then not knowing what it was set as and what I was comfortable with.
This ensures the window always opens with my preffered scale.
2025-11-19 10:39:51 +01:00
8a48629300
update i3
2025-11-19 10:39:51 +01:00
8b8135ad44
update nvim
2025-11-19 10:39:51 +01:00
a5ff706dbb
update clang-format to be more in line with my current preferences / guidelines
2025-11-19 10:39:51 +01:00
0d028ac000
show the cursor in the the shell prompt
2025-11-19 10:39:51 +01:00
b45367b194
fix: spelling
2025-11-19 10:39:51 +01:00
6eb7ffafa5
fix: MULTI+.+= does not give DOT OPERATOR, as I expected, but BULLET. BULLET has been moved to ** and DOT OPERATOR set at .=
2025-11-19 10:39:51 +01:00
4643ef0d8f
fix: OMEGA is using the wrong UTF code
2025-11-19 10:39:51 +01:00
54d606a00c
minor symbol name fixes
2025-11-19 10:39:51 +01:00
a96e0bf7e2
expand the greek alphabet, now all symbols have been added.
...
note: I thought I did this last time.
2025-11-19 10:39:51 +01:00
c4e8803003
set NVIDIA as primary gpu
2025-11-19 10:39:51 +01:00
99d4b527ad
modify inputrc to have completions to be coloured, and case-insensitive.
2025-11-19 10:39:51 +01:00
a47ceb6eb8
remove setting the tab width for makefile to four
2025-11-19 10:39:51 +01:00
69b21a4372
comment out the java-prime exported envs, since we're now running on just dedicated graphics
2025-11-19 10:39:51 +01:00
1e10ed0052
update nvim
2025-11-19 10:39:51 +01:00
8dea8ab696
rewrite polybar networks once again
2025-11-19 10:39:51 +01:00
0e4dd1d9cf
removal of hyfetch, and preferring to use a more customised fastfetch configuration
2025-11-19 10:39:51 +01:00
773f494a22
add lls alias
2025-11-19 10:39:51 +01:00
c546d1c3b2
modify history settings
2025-11-19 10:39:51 +01:00
e1387b2dca
update submodules
2025-11-19 10:39:51 +01:00
61976629ea
fix: polybar ethernet connections
2025-11-19 10:39:51 +01:00
38112b8277
update cpusetcores binary
2025-11-19 10:39:51 +01:00
9f2dec9534
update nvim
2025-11-19 10:39:51 +01:00
18c94a7621
update feh on errors with satalite-wp-update
2025-11-19 10:39:51 +01:00
19305ad9be
add another definition for USB ethernet device
2025-11-19 10:39:51 +01:00
895da1eeeb
update submodules
2025-11-19 10:39:51 +01:00
e2c314ae11
fix double comment
2025-11-19 10:39:51 +01:00
1b7d5537f8
add an alias for rm to set -I, which is less intruisive than -i
2025-11-19 10:39:51 +01:00
3a586f187a
fix: formatting
2025-11-19 10:39:51 +01:00
6fee92f45a
enable globstar in bashrc
2025-11-19 10:39:51 +01:00
a61a223cff
update i3
2025-11-19 10:39:51 +01:00
27cc9a379b
fix: submodule paths were incorrect
2025-11-19 10:39:51 +01:00
5f9d1758ca
fix: git modules url's weren't reflective of what they actually are
2025-11-19 10:39:51 +01:00
d918dd43ea
change projection settings to be better parameterised
2025-11-19 10:39:51 +01:00
2e1eb80047
update nvim
2025-11-19 10:39:51 +01:00
faf1c37f99
make UTF-8 and LF uppercase
2025-11-19 10:39:51 +01:00
c6197743fb
add some extra languages around the C-based languages
2025-11-19 10:39:51 +01:00
e59d65b8e4
remove redundant indent_size=tab
2025-11-19 10:39:51 +01:00
f2255cd499
add comments
2025-11-19 10:39:51 +01:00
77fce2e707
update nvim
2025-11-19 10:39:51 +01:00
cd8174e281
add cs to the forcibly use category
2025-11-19 10:39:51 +01:00
cc6007ebac
add a comment for a forces 4 spaces catagory
2025-11-19 10:39:51 +01:00
9b889178a7
correct definition order
2025-11-19 10:39:51 +01:00
4eebf67f80
split apart the web languages into it's own definition
2025-11-19 10:39:51 +01:00
434a9a7c9a
remove markdown from the json/jsonc/css/scss column
2025-11-19 10:39:51 +01:00
d374003757
set tab width to 4 for those that were <4
2025-11-19 10:39:51 +01:00
a9b3840c63
edit clang-format to be on-par with my current preferred style
2025-11-19 10:39:51 +01:00
b45ee0960e
add notifications for audio (they're rubbish, but eh)
2025-11-19 10:39:51 +01:00
63c90d6009
move some desktop i3 behaviour into different shell scripts
2025-11-19 10:39:51 +01:00
aeafbab5ca
make shell scripts more POSIX-compatible, and use tabs instead of spaces
2025-11-19 10:39:51 +01:00
7e4a40d7c4
we don't need to specify user
2025-11-19 10:39:51 +01:00
ca446dfd45
remove include header warnings, as they're often incorrect
2025-11-19 10:39:51 +01:00
5882849282
add some clang-tidy options to clangd config
2025-11-19 10:39:51 +01:00
9875c36db5
add parameters to be able to fill the whole screen
2025-11-19 10:39:51 +01:00
43dd74625d
modify parameters to fit within my monitor
2025-11-19 10:39:51 +01:00
424202d50c
parameterise the projection settings
2025-11-19 10:39:51 +01:00
0767e30fab
set the output directory to static due to cronnie problems
2025-11-19 10:39:50 +01:00
b001d9ef83
update submodules
2025-11-19 10:39:18 +01:00
9bdd6826bc
make background image transparent
2025-11-19 10:39:18 +01:00
82a9bc823b
convert is deprecated, use magick
2025-11-19 10:39:18 +01:00
a704635f33
add background removal
2025-11-19 10:39:18 +01:00
287482b052
update satalite-wp-update script to use the proper API ends
2025-11-19 10:39:15 +01:00
235d53dd2e
update nvim
2025-11-19 10:37:21 +01:00
c3b0685ab6
add jsonc to editorconfig
2025-11-19 10:37:21 +01:00
faaa81d0fa
change default tab_width to 8
2025-11-19 10:37:21 +01:00
ca0db5f3d4
remove inconsistent tab widths form editorconfig
2025-11-19 10:37:21 +01:00
396c9dd83b
add gitea key to SSH_AUTH_SOCK
2025-11-19 10:37:21 +01:00
75073f9de6
configure gitconfig to only use gpgSign on tags.
2025-11-19 10:37:21 +01:00
dbe1c45d02
update nvim
2025-11-19 10:37:21 +01:00
9f7a1b594f
update clang format formatting rules to be up to par with my current preferences
2025-11-19 10:37:21 +01:00
2f31b9c6e8
strip end of line comments from clang-format
2025-11-19 10:37:21 +01:00
b451626950
include xprofile
2025-11-19 10:37:21 +01:00
d9aec282c8
remove localtmp
2025-11-19 10:37:21 +01:00
1832c25a18
write satalite connect script
2025-11-19 10:37:16 +01:00